A low level of albumin in the blood can be caused by malnutrition, too much water in the body, liver disease, kidney disease, severe injury such as burns or major bone fractures, and slow bleeding over a long period of time. Poor nutrition and malabsorption are the other factors responsible for lowering albumin levels For instance, intestinal disorders such as Crohn’s disease interfere with normal absorption and digestion of protein. Albumin is the largest protein component of the serum (the watery part of your blood that contains disease-fighting antibodies). These cookies do not store any personal information. A serum albumin test is recommended in case of individuals who have been experiencing symptoms such as jaundice, fatigue, unexplained weight loss, swelling around the legs, abdomen and eyes, etc. When albumin levels become very low, fluid can leak from blood vessels into nearby tissues, causing swelling in the feet and ankles. Honestly speaking, urine should not contain albumin, as protein molecules are large and so easily get trapped in the kidney’s filters and finally they are reabsorbed in the blood stream.
